Output e34eaf5ca2897197f9ec7ef20a959fea34de4429649fbb95f049ba248ff92f9a:2

value
13000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b43c48b0553253fb232204354da54d610316d45 OP_EQUAL
address
MBqvUGHt47Qnak9GC22yAfhtkRxhuDoGQH
transaction
e34eaf5ca2897197f9ec7ef20a959fea34de4429649fbb95f049ba248ff92f9a
spent
true